La base de données Oracle est l'une des bases de données les plus populaires aujourd'hui, et sa fiabilité et sa stabilité ont été reconnues par de nombreuses entreprises. Cependant, lors de l'utilisation de la base de données Oracle, il est extrêmement courant que la vérification échoue. Examinons les raisons de l'échec de la vérification Oracle et comment le résoudre.
1. Raisons de l'échec de la vérification Oracle
1. Défaillance physique : la défaillance physique est la raison la plus courante d'échec de la vérification Oracle, notamment une défaillance de la mémoire, une défaillance de la transmission réseau et une défaillance matérielle. , etc. . Si une défaillance physique se produit, le processus de vérification Oracle peut être interrompu, entraînant un échec.
- Exception de base de données : s'il y a des données anormales dans la base de données Oracle, telles qu'une reconstruction de données incomplète, une suppression de données incomplète, etc., la vérification Oracle échouera.
- Problèmes de configuration : S'il y a des erreurs ou des configurations incomplètes dans le fichier de configuration du service Oracle, cela affectera le fonctionnement normal d'Oracle, provoquant l'échec de la vérification Oracle.
- Problème d'autorisation : L'utilisateur Oracle ne dispose pas de droits d'accès suffisants, ce qui entraînera l'échec de la vérification Oracle.
2. Comment résoudre le problème d'échec de la vérification Oracle
- Vérifiez les défauts physiques : Tout d'abord, vous devez vérifier si l'appareil a défauts physiques, tels que des pannes de disque. Après avoir confirmé qu'il n'y a aucun problème avec l'état physique du matériel en raison de modifications du réseau, etc., vérifiez si les fichiers de données sont endommagés et s'il y a des informations anormales dans les journaux système.
- Vérifiez les exceptions de la base de données : utilisez la commande DBVERIFY d'Oracle pour vérifier la base de données afin de rechercher et de corriger tout bloc de données corrompu ou incohérent. Lors de la vérification de la base de données, vous devez également consulter le journal des erreurs pour comprendre la situation d'erreur dans la base de données et la gérer en fonction des informations sur l'erreur.
- Vérifiez le fichier de configuration : Localisez si le fichier de configuration du service Oracle est incorrect, et utilisez le fichier de configuration de sauvegarde pour le restaurer si nécessaire. La modification du fichier de configuration nécessite les autorisations correspondantes. Si les autorisations sont insuffisantes, vous devez contacter l'administrateur ou le développeur.
- Vérifier les problèmes d'autorisation : S'il s'agit d'un problème d'autorisation qui entraîne l'échec de la vérification Oracle, vous devez vérifier si vous disposez d'autorisations suffisantes, telles que sysdba ou sysoper et d'autres autorisations avancées. Il existe également un processus d'autorisation pour obtenir les autorisations requises.
3. Comment éviter l'échec de la vérification Oracle
- Sauvegarde de la base de données : La sauvegarde de la base de données est une mesure importante pour éviter la perte de données. sauvegardez régulièrement la base de données pour éviter que la perte de données entraîne l'échec de la vérification Oracle.
- Maintenance régulière : la maintenance régulière d'Oracle et l'optimisation des performances, telles que le nettoyage des données inutiles, l'optimisation des instructions de requête SQL, etc., peuvent éviter le problème de l'échec des vérifications.
- Gestion de la sécurité : des mesures complètes de gestion de la sécurité peuvent prévenir efficacement les attaques de pirates informatiques et les dommages malveillants. Il est recommandé de renforcer la gestion de la sécurité de la base de données, par exemple en améliorant le contrôle des autorisations des utilisateurs et en renforçant la protection par mot de passe.
En bref, lors de l'utilisation de la base de données Oracle, l'échec de la vérification est inévitable, mais nous pouvons vérifier et résoudre le problème, et également renforcer la gestion de la maintenance et de la sécurité de la base de données pour éviter un échec de vérification s'est produit.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!
Déclaration: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n